"Most importantly, Cape Coral worked with Comcate to create a user-friendly portal through which citizens can submit public records requests. Requests submitted through the public portal are automatically routed to the proper staff person without any initial work on the agency’s part. This has reduced the number of requests that agency staff have to manually log from phone and email by 30% , estimates Craig and saves the agency time and money . Finally, Craig is excited to see the utilization of Comcate growing throughout the agency and sees tremendous potential in the partnership between his agency and the company."
